// REINDEX_BATCH_CAP limits docs per shard pass in the Tallowfield
// nightly search reindex. Raising it starves the ingest queue;
// lowering it overruns the maintenance window. 5000 is the tested
// sweet spot. Change only with a soak run. Verified against the
// build noted below.

session token of bawif-hahog = htk6_ac5981

## Runbook: Lintwood UI Kit Versioning

The shared component library publishes from the `stable` branch only. Tags are immutable; republishing a version is blocked by the Fernvale registry. Consumers must pin exact versions — ranges are rejected at build time. Security review should confirm provenance attestation is enabled and the signing step runs before publish. The registry and signing settings are as follows.

deployment values, yadup-kadug:
[sorys]
port = 5672
team = noveth
host = sorys.orvexcorp.example
region = south-4
access_code = ac_deddc1
timeout_ms = 1500

Cold starts on Lumenfall serverless handlers typically add 800–1500 ms to the first invocation after an idle period of ten minutes. When a customer reports intermittent latency, check the handler's warm-pool setting before escalating; most reports trace back to pools sized at zero. To reproduce cold-start behavior against the staging gateway yourself, invoke the diagnostics endpoint with the internal service credential shown directly below.

gateway credential: kto23_LX9A4ys6i4nzHtpOLNLodKK

Data-Centre Cage Visits

All cage visits at the Fennbright facility must be pre-booked through the Opsview calendar. Reception confirms the visitor's name against the booking, issues a red escort lanyard, and notifies the duty engineer. Escorts remain with visitors at all times. To open the cage corridor for the escort, use the access code below.

door code, bahop-fawep: bdg-VTAUT-0